In "The Stones of Venice," John Ruskin offers a profound exploration of architecture, art, and the moral underpinnings of society. This multi-volume work deftly combines vivid descriptions, detailed analyses, and historical insights, delving deep into the construction and aesthetics of Venetian architecture as a reflection of cultural values. Ruskin employs an evocative literary style rich in metaphor and symbolism, illuminating how the intricate details of buildings inspire both moral contemplation and societal critique. Its context emerges from the Victorian era's fascination with art and history, against the backdrop of burgeoning industrialization that threatened traditional craftsmanship. John Ruskin, a pivotal figure in the Victorian art movement, was an ardent advocate for craftsmanship and the beauty of nature, deeply influenced by his environmental convictions and a reverence for medieval artistry. His extensive travels in Europe, particularly his admiration for Venice, fueled his belief that architecture is a moral and philosophical reflection of its time. Ruskin's commitment to social reform and his concern for the decline of artisan craftsmanship are evident throughout this work, as he seeks to reconnect art with ethical living.
